Understanding the Link Between NSAIDs, Age, and Ulcer Risk
Nonsteroidal anti-inflammatory drugs (NSAIDs) are a class of medications widely used to manage pain, fever, and inflammation. Common examples include ibuprofen and naproxen. While effective, their mechanism of action—inhibiting the production of prostaglandins—also impairs the natural protective lining of the stomach and intestine. This makes the gastrointestinal (GI) tract more vulnerable to acid damage, potentially leading to ulcer formation.
For adults older than 65, this risk is significantly higher. Aging causes natural changes in the GI tract, including a reduction in mucosal repair capacity, which diminishes the body's ability to protect itself. When combined with the widespread and often long-term use of NSAIDs in this age group for chronic conditions like arthritis, the potential for complications increases dramatically.
The Dose-Dependent Relationship: Higher Dose, Higher Risk
Research has conclusively shown that the risk of gastrointestinal complications, including serious ulcer disease, is directly tied to the dosage and duration of NSAID therapy. A higher dose means a more potent inhibition of the protective prostaglandins, leaving the gastric and duodenal mucosa more susceptible to erosion and ulceration. For older adults, who are already at a heightened baseline risk, this dose-dependent effect becomes even more critical. Clinicians often emphasize using the lowest effective dose for the shortest possible duration to minimize these risks.
Additional Compounding Risk Factors for Seniors
Beyond dose and age, several other factors can significantly increase the risk of serious ulcer disease in older adults taking NSAIDs. These compounding elements make careful management essential:
- Concomitant Medication Use: The use of other drugs, such as aspirin (even low-dose), corticosteroids, anticoagulants (like warfarin), and certain antiplatelet agents, drastically amplifies the GI risk. This is particularly concerning as many older adults are on complex medication regimens for multiple health conditions.
- History of Ulcer Disease: A previous history of peptic ulcer disease is one of the most powerful predictors of future ulcer recurrence, especially when continuing NSAID therapy without preventive measures.
- H. pylori Infection: This bacterial infection is a major cause of peptic ulcers. The synergistic effect of an
H. pylori
infection and NSAID use can substantially increase the likelihood of ulceration and bleeding. - Chronic Health Conditions: Conditions such as heart failure, hypertension, and advanced kidney disease further complicate NSAID use, increasing the overall risk profile for the elderly patient.
Strategies to Mitigate Risk for Older Adults
Given the heightened risk, preventing NSAID-induced ulcers is a critical aspect of senior care. These strategies can help minimize harm:
- Consult a Healthcare Provider: Before starting or changing an NSAID regimen, discuss all risk factors with a doctor. They can assess individual risks and explore safer alternatives.
- Use Lowest Effective Dose: Adhere to the principle of using the lowest possible dose for the shortest duration necessary to manage symptoms. This directly addresses the dose-dependent risk.
- Co-Prescription of Gastroprotective Agents: For high-risk individuals, a healthcare provider may co-prescribe a proton pump inhibitor (PPI) or an H2-receptor antagonist to protect the stomach lining.
- Consider Alternative Pain Management: Explore non-NSAID options such as acetaminophen for pain relief, or non-pharmacological approaches like physical therapy and topical pain relievers.
- Address
H. pylori
: For patients with a knownH. pylori
infection who require NSAIDs, eradication therapy for the bacteria is recommended.
Comparison of Non-selective vs. COX-2 Selective NSAIDs
While all NSAIDs carry a GI risk, some are considered safer for the stomach than others. However, a key trade-off often exists with cardiovascular (CV) risk, making patient-specific evaluation crucial.
Feature | Non-Selective NSAIDs (e.g., Ibuprofen, Naproxen) | COX-2 Selective NSAIDs (e.g., Celecoxib) |
---|---|---|
Mechanism | Inhibits both COX-1 and COX-2 enzymes | Primarily inhibits COX-2 enzyme |
GI Risk | Higher risk of bleeding and ulceration, especially at higher doses | Lower risk of GI complications compared to non-selective NSAIDs |
Cardiovascular Risk | Variable, some studies link long-term use to increased CV risk | Potential increased risk of thrombotic events (e.g., heart attack, stroke), necessitating caution |
Dose-Response | Risk clearly increases with higher doses and longer duration | Risk also increases with higher doses, though generally with a safer GI profile |
Who it's For | Patients with lower baseline GI and CV risk profiles; short-term use | Patients with higher GI risk factors but lower CV risk; requires careful assessment |
It is imperative that patients and their doctors weigh the potential benefits and risks of each type of NSAID based on the individual's full medical history. Conclusion: A Multifaceted Risk Requiring Careful Management
In summary, the risk of serious ulcer disease is indeed increased with higher doses of NSAIDs for adults over 65, but it is not the only contributing factor. Advanced age itself, combined with other medical conditions and concurrent medications, creates a complex risk profile. Effective management involves using the lowest possible dose, utilizing gastroprotective agents when necessary, and exploring safer alternatives. A detailed conversation with a healthcare provider is essential for any older adult on or considering NSAID therapy to ensure a safe and effective pain management plan that protects gastrointestinal health.
